Competitive Landscape of the Plaque Modification Devices Market
The Plaque Modification Devices Market is highly competitive, characterized by the presence of several global and regional players offering a wide range of products. Key companies in the market, such as Boston Scientific Corporation, B. Braun Melsungen, BD (Becton Dickinson and Company), Cardinal Health, Medtronic, and others, dominate through their extensive product portfolios, strong distribution networks, and focus on innovation.
In June 2024, Boston Scientific announced a definitive agreement to acquire Silk Road Medical, Inc., a company specializing in minimally invasive products for stroke prevention in patients with carotid artery disease. This strategic move aims to enhance Boston Scientific's vascular portfolio and address plaque-related conditions. https://news.bostonscientific.com/2024-06-18-Boston-Scientific-Announces-Agreement-to-Acquire-Silk-Road-Medical,-Inc In March 2021, Medtronic will offer the HawkOne™ Directional Atherectomy System, designed to treat peripheral arterial disease by removing plaque in both above-the-knee interventions. This system addresses various plaque morphologies, including severe calcium deposits. https://www.medtronic.com/en-us/healthcare-professionals/products/cardiovascular/directional-atherectomy-systems/hawkone-directional-atherectomy-system.html

Introduction of the Plaque Modification Devices Market
Plaque Modification Devices Market is observing vast growth owing to the increasing prevalence of cardiovascular diseases (CVD) and evolving technologies for minimally invasive procedures. Arterial plaque accumulation or atherosclerosis is one of the main causes of heart attack and stroke; there is a stringent need for good medical procedures. Plaque modification equipment, including atherectomy devices, laser systems, and balloons, is intended to ablate or alter arterial plaque, enhancing blood flow and minimizing the likelihood of major cardiovascular events. Government programs and healthcare policies promoting cardiovascular wellness are further driving market growth. Organizations such as the World Health Organization (WHO) and the National Institutes of Health (NIH) emphasize the need for early diagnosis and proper treatment to control CVDs. Moreover, advances in technology, such as AI-based imaging devices and bioresorbable stents, are transforming plaque modification procedures, rendering treatments safer and more effective. Nevertheless, factors such as the high cost of devices, regulatory requirements, and reliance on imports could slow down market growth, particularly in developing countries.
In March 2024, Boston Scientific received U.S. FDA approval for the AGENT™ Drug-Coated Balloon, designed to treat coronary in-stent restenosis. This innovation offers a safe and effective alternative to traditional therapies, aiming to reduce the recurrence of arterial plaque buildup. https://news.bostonscientific.com/2024-03-01-Boston-Scientific-Receives-FDA-Approval-for-the-AGENT-TM-Drug-Coated-Balloon#:~:text=MARLBOROUGH%2C%20Mass.%2C%20March%201,patients%20with%20coronary%20artery%20disease.
